### Account Recovery — Catalogue Import (Lintwood)

Quick one for review: when the Lintwood catalogue import wipes a patron's session table, the recovery flow re-seeds accounts from the nightly snapshot. Check that the importer skips locked accounts — last time it didn't. To rerun recovery against staging you'll need the vault passphrase, which is appended just below.

recovery phrase for yafof-tajof: julmir-kelax-julvan-holath-belvan-holir-ralael-ralvan-ralath-julvan-silmir-istmir-kaswyn-ulamir

Defaults changed for experiment assignment. Sticky bucketing is now on by default, so users keep their variant across sessions; previously assignments were recomputed per request, which skewed metrics for long-running experiments. The default hash salt rotation interval also moved from weekly to per-experiment.

Existing experiments are unaffected until restarted. New experiments created in the Farrowden console inherit these defaults immediately. The updated default configuration is listed below.

deployment values, yadug-bawif:
[framir]
team = pelox
access_code = ac_a38ab2
owner = tamion.julael
host = framir.tolvaqlabs.test
port = 11211
peer = tammir.zemvargrid.local
salt = 2215ef03
pin = 1541

### Audit item 14: Spreadsheet export memory ceiling

Verify that the Ledgermint export service streams rows instead of buffering full workbooks, and that the 1.5GB per-job memory cap is enforced in config. New team members: check the monthly export dashboard for OOM restarts before signing off. Any deviation must be reported to the owner of this control, named below.

account owner for fajep-yagef: Kasix Eliiel

## Ticket: Schema registry drift between staging and prod

The Corvane event schema registry in prod has diverged from staging: compatibility mode and retention settings no longer match the manifests in the infra repo. Likely cause is a manual hotfix applied during the March incident that was never backported.

Future maintainers: treat the repo as source of truth.

For reference, prod currently reports these values.

service settings:
[silwyn]
host = silwyn.crelvogrid.internal
user = silwyn_svc
database = silwyn_prod